Hollow Other Woba 3 is a very bold, very wide, very high cont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A heavy, right-slanted display face with broad, squared forms and sharply chamfered corners. The letterforms are built from chunky strokes interrupted by deliberate interior knockouts and notched cut-ins, producing a hollowed, stencil-like rhythm across the alphabet. Counters are compact and often rectangular, and many glyphs show wedge terminals and stepped joints that emphasize forward motion. Overall spacing is tight and the silhouettes read as strong blocks, while the repeated cutouts keep the texture busy and high-energy in lines of text.
Best used for large headlines, posters, and title treatments where its slant and carved interior details can be appreciated. It also fits sports branding, gaming or streaming graphics, and bold logo wordmarks that aim for motion and intensity rather than long-form readability.
The font projects speed and impact, with a motorsport and action-title attitude. Its carved, mechanical details give it a tough, engineered feel—more loud and performative than neutral—suited to attention-grabbing, adrenaline-forward messaging.
The design appears intended to deliver a forward-leaning, high-impact display voice by combining broad, italicized proportions with decorative internal knockouts that suggest speed, machinery, and stylized force.
In the sample text, the internal cuts create lively patterning that can dominate at smaller sizes; the design reads best when given room to breathe. Numerals follow the same notched, hollowed construction, keeping a consistent voice across alphanumerics.
